LiConvFormer: A lightweight fault diagnosis framework using separable multiscale convolution and broadcast self-attention

被引:179
作者
Yan, Shen [1 ]
Shao, Haidong [1 ]
Wang, Jie [1 ]
Zheng, Xinyu [1 ]
Liu, Bin [2 ]
机构
[1] Hunan Univ, Coll Mech & Vehicle Engn, Changsha 410082, Peoples R China
[2] Univ Strathclyde, Dept Management Sci, Glasgow G1 1XQ, Scotland
关键词
Lightweight framework; LiConvFormer; Fault diagnosis; Separable multiscale convolution; Broadcast self-attention; SPEED;
D O I
10.1016/j.eswa.2023.121338
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
In recent studies, Transformer collaborated with convolution neural network (CNN) have made certain progress in the field of intelligent fault diagnosis by leveraging their respective advantages of global and local feature extraction. However, the multihead self-attention block used by Transformer and cross-channel convolution mechanism existing in CNN would make the collaborative models overly complex, leading to higher hardware requirements and limited industrial application scenarios. Therefore, this paper proposes a lightweight fault diagnosis framework called LiConvFormer to address the aforementioned challenges. First, a separable multi scale convolution block is designed to extract multilocal receptive field features of vibration signals and greatly reduce the learning parameters and computations. Second, a broadcast self-attention block is developed to capture critical fine-grained features within the signal's global scope, while avoiding cumbersome operations such as matrix multiplication and multidimensional exponentiation. Experimental results on three mechanical systems show that the proposed framework can accommodate advantages of lightweight and robustness compared to the recent Transformer and CNN-based fault diagnosis methods; moreover, the superiority of the above two blocks is also verified. The code library is available at: https://github.com/yanshen0210/LiC onvFormer-a-lightweight-fault-diagnosis-framework.
引用
收藏
页数:14
相关论文
共 37 条
[1]   Hybrid model-driven and data-driven approach for the health assessment of axial piston pumps [J].
Chao, Qun ;
Xu, Zi ;
Shao, Yuechen ;
Tao, Jianfeng ;
Liu, Chengliang ;
Ding, Shuo .
INTERNATIONAL JOURNAL OF HYDROMECHATRONICS, 2023, 6 (01) :76-92
[2]   Multi-channel Calibrated Transformer with Shifted Windows for few-shot fault diagnosis under sharp speed variation [J].
Chen, Zhuohang ;
Chen, Jinglong ;
Liu, Shen ;
Feng, Yong ;
He, Shuilong ;
Xu, Enyong .
ISA TRANSACTIONS, 2022, 131 :501-515
[3]  
Dai Z, 2021, ADV NEUR IN, V34
[4]   HS-KDNet: A Lightweight Network Based on Hierarchical-Split Block and Knowledge Distillation for Fault Diagnosis With Extremely Imbalanced Data [J].
Deng, Jin ;
Jiang, Wenjuan ;
Zhang, Ye ;
Wang, Gong ;
Li, Sheng ;
Fang, Hairui .
IEEE TRANSACTIONS ON INSTRUMENTATION AND MEASUREMENT, 2021, 70
[5]   Convolutional Transformer: An Enhanced Attention Mechanism Architecture for Remaining Useful Life Estimation of Bearings [J].
Ding, Yifei ;
Jia, Minping .
IEEE TRANSACTIONS ON INSTRUMENTATION AND MEASUREMENT, 2022, 71
[6]   A novel time-frequency Transformer based on self-attention mechanism and its application in fault diagnosis of rolling bearings [J].
Ding, Yifei ;
Jia, Minping ;
Miao, Qiuhua ;
Cao, Yudong .
MECHANICAL SYSTEMS AND SIGNAL PROCESSING, 2022, 168
[7]  
Dosovitskiy A., 2021, Learning
[8]   You can get smaller: A lightweight self-activation convolution unit modified by transformer for fault diagnosis [J].
Fang, HaiRui ;
Deng, Jin ;
Chen, DongSheng ;
Jiang, WenJuan ;
Shao, SiYu ;
Tang, MingCong ;
Liu, JingJing .
ADVANCED ENGINEERING INFORMATICS, 2023, 55
[9]   CLFormer: A Lightweight Transformer Based on Convolutional Embedding and Linear Self-Attention With Strong Robustness for Bearing Fault Diagnosis Under Limited Sample Conditions [J].
Fang, Hairui ;
Deng, Jin ;
Bai, Yaoxu ;
Feng, Bo ;
Li, Sheng ;
Shao, Siyu ;
Chen, Dongsheng .
IEEE TRANSACTIONS ON INSTRUMENTATION AND MEASUREMENT, 2022, 71
[10]  
Howard AG, 2017, Arxiv, DOI [arXiv:1704.04861, 10.48550/arXiv.1704.04861]